Minnesota Morris overcame a sluggish start with a 20-2 run midway through the first half, to defeat Crown College for the second time in just eight days, 80-23 in Upper Midwest Athletic Conference (UMAC) women’s basketball Saturday at the UMM P.E. Center.
As impressive as a 20-2 run is, UMM had another to top it. The Cougars held the Storm scoreless through the first 11 minutes of the second half, and were on a 25-0 run, dating back to the first half, when Crown finally made their first basket in the second.
Tynell Kocer (So. Pierre, SD) and Alaina Benson (Jr. Clinton, MN) opened up
a 4-0 lead for the Cougars with a pair of scores. A 3-pointer by Crown’s Jenny Moll would tie the game for the Storm 7 minutes in to half, but that was as close to the lead as the Storm would get.
A layup by Coresa Leighty (So. New Ulm, MN) would get the Cougars started on that 20-2 run, which saw Benson score 13 of her 15 first half points.
A score by Bronwyn Weiss at the 6 minute mark would end the 7 and a half minute scoreless streak for the Storm, and the Cougars would take a 41-18 lead into the locker room at the half.
The Cougar’s outscored the Storm 16-0 of the bench in the first half, and scored 14 of their 41 points off turnovers.
The second half wouldn’t be any kinder to Crown, as they were outscored by the Cougars 39-5.
The 19-0 run to start the half was a true team effort, with eight different Cougars getting a chance to score. The run ended with a pair of lay-ups by Kristie Swensted (Fr. Osakis, MN) and a jumper by Tynell Kocer, when Stephanie Zroka finally put Crown on the board, with 8:55 left on the clock.
Crown wasn’t able to add too much more, and the Cougars finished out the win 80-23.
This game was a great example of a team effort, with four players scoring in double figures, and every player that wore a jersey for the Cougars scored at least two points.
Alaina Benson led all scorers with 17. Coresa Leighty added 14, Annika Bergman (Sr. Superior, WI) had 13, and Tynell Kocer contributed 11. Jaime Rainey (So. Maple Grove, MN) also added a game high 11 assists.
The Cougars also had a season low eight turnovers in the game.
Minnesota Morris (9-10, 6-3 UMAC) travels to Minneapolis to take on North Central University on Monday, February 5th at 5:30 in their final non-conference game of the season.
